Tom Cruise is reportedly set to take to the skies once again, this time with ‘Top Gun 3’. According to the latest buzz, the actor is poised to secure one of the biggest paydays in Hollywood history as he prepares to reprise his iconic role as Pete ‘Maverick’ Mitchell in ‘Top Gun 3’.Daily Mail reports that the actor, who previously earned an estimated GBP 75 million for ‘Top Gun: Maverick’ (2022), the blockbuster sequel to the 1986 original, is now set to cross the GBP 100 million bar, largely due to a lucrative deal. As per the report, Cruise is expected to score the huge paycheque for the third instalment. In addition to starring, he will also return as a producer on the franchise, and is also expected to get a share of the film’s box office profits.Cruise is said to be receiving an upfront salary of approximately GBP 18 million, along with around 8 per cent of the film’s profits. If ‘Top Gun 3’ is able to hit the GBP 1 billion mark, Cruise stands to get an estimated GBP 75 million from just the profits.If the numbers add up, Cruise will join a long list of stars like Robert Downey Jr who reportedly scored a USD 100 million paycheque for his return to the MUC in ‘Avengers: Doomsday’. Actor Ryan Reynolds also earned an estimated USD 100 million total for the billion-dollar hit ‘Deadpool & Wolverine’.Cruise is also no stranger to the USD 100 million club, he previously took a massive cut of box office and streaming revenue for films including ‘Mission: Impossible 2’ and ‘War of the Worlds’.It was announced last week that a third part of the hit franchise was in the works, with a film is slated for a summer 2028 release. The news was officially confirmed by Josh Greenstein, during CinemaCon in Las Vegas last week. Producer Jerry Bruckheimer, Cruise and co-writer Ehren Kruger are already developing the script.Directed by Joseph Kosinski, ‘Top Gun: Maverick’ also featured Miles Teller and Glen Powell as young pilots mentored by Cruise’s character. While Cruise is reportedly set for his return, it is unclear if the supporting cast will be brought back for the third part.
